Job Description

Primary Function of Position

We are looking for a Data Engineer to build and own the data foundations that power machine learning and analytics. This role is focused on designing scalable data platforms, organizing high-quality datasets, and enabling ML scientists to efficiently develop, train, and deploy models.

You will work closely with ML scientists, data scientists, and software engineers to ensure data is reliable, discoverable, and production ready.

What Success Would Look Like:

•              ML scientists can easily access trusted, well-documented data

•              Data pipelines are reliable, observable, and scalable

•              Data quality issues are detected early and resolved quickly

•              The data platform accelerates ML development and deployment

Essential Job Duties

  • Data Platform & Pipelines
    • Design, build, and maintain scalable, reliable data pipelines for batch and streaming data
    • Own data ingestion, transformation, validation, and storage across multiple sources
    • Optimize data systems for performance and reliability
    • Monitor and troubleshoot data pipeline failures and data quality issues
  • Data Organization & Quality
    • Structure and organize datasets to support ML training, evaluation, and inference
    • Define and maintain schemas, metadata, and data documentation
    • Implement data quality checks, validation frameworks, and monitoring
    • Support data versioning, lineage, and reproducibility
  • ML Enablement
    • Partner closely with ML scientists to understand data requirements
    • Build and maintain feature pipelines and ML-ready datasets
    • Support ML workflows by ensuring consistent, high-quality data inputs
    • Enable smooth handoff from experimentation to production
  • Collaboration & Standards
    • Collaborate with product, analytics, and engineering teams to align data solutions with business needs
    • Establish best practices for data modeling, pipeline design, and governance
    • Contribute to architectural decisions for data and ML platforms

U.S. Export Controls Disclaimer:  In accordance with the U.S. Export Administration Regulations (15 CFR §743.13(b)), some roles at Intuitive Surgical may be subject to U.S. export controls for prospective employees
who are nationals from countries currently on embargo or sanctions status.

Certain information you provide as part of the application will be used for purposes of determining whether Intuitive Surgical will need to (i) obtain an export license from the U.S. Government on your behalf (note: the government’s licensing process can take 3 to 6+ months) or (ii) implement a Technology Control Plan (“TCP”) (note: typically adds 2 weeks to the hiring process).  

For any Intuitive role subject to export controls, final offers are contingent upon obtaining an approved export license and/or an executed TCP prior to the prospective employee’s
start date, which may or may not be flexible, and within a timeframe that does not unreasonably impede the hiring need. If applicable, candidates will be notified and instructed on any requirements for these purposes.
